Understanding Beta-Alanine and Its Cumulative Effect
Beta-alanine is a non-essential amino acid crucial for synthesizing carnosine, stored in muscles. Carnosine acts as a buffer against acidity during intense exercise, which helps delay fatigue and improves performance. Increasing muscle carnosine levels through beta-alanine supplementation allows for harder and longer training sessions.
Unlike immediate-acting supplements such as caffeine, beta-alanine's benefits are cumulative, meaning they build over time with consistent use. It typically takes at least four weeks of daily supplementation (around 4-6 grams per day) to significantly raise muscle carnosine levels and experience noticeable effects. This long-term saturation, rather than the timing of individual doses, is the key to its effectiveness.
The Flexibility of Beta-Alanine Dosing
Given that the benefits rely on maintaining elevated muscle carnosine levels, the specific time of day you take beta-alanine is not critical. You can consume your daily dose whenever it's most convenient – morning, with meals, or pre-workout – without impacting its primary effects. The crucial factor is consistent daily intake, even on rest days, to ensure continuous carnosine saturation.

Mitigating Paresthesia
A common, harmless side effect is paresthesia, a tingling or prickling sensation. This is dose-dependent and temporary. To minimize it:
- Split your daily dose into smaller servings throughout the day.
- Choose a sustained-release form of beta-alanine.
- Take beta-alanine with food, especially carbohydrates, which may aid absorption and reduce tingling.
Combining with Other Supplements
Beta-alanine is often combined with other supplements like creatine. Creatine aids immediate high-intensity efforts, while beta-alanine helps buffer acidity during longer intense bursts (1-4 minutes). Combining them can enhance performance, with creatine primarily boosting maximal strength. Taking them together is flexible, and consistent use is key. Beta-Alanine vs. Acute-Effect Supplements
Comparing beta-alanine to supplements with immediate effects, like caffeine, highlights why timing is less crucial.
| Feature | Beta-Alanine (Cumulative) | Caffeine (Acute) |
|---|---|---|
| Primary Mechanism | Increases muscle carnosine to buffer acidity and delay fatigue. | Acts as a central nervous system stimulant, reducing perceived pain and enhancing focus. |
| Timing Importance | Not Important. Benefits come from consistent, long-term saturation of muscle carnosine. | Highly Important. Should be taken 30-60 minutes before exercise for immediate effects. |
| Onset of Effects | Weeks (typically 2-4 weeks minimum for noticeable benefits). | Minutes (15-60 minutes after ingestion). |
| Effect on Performance | Enhanced endurance and capacity during high-intensity exercise (1–10 minutes). | Increased energy, focus, and reduced perception of effort. |
| Primary Side Effect | Paresthesia (tingling), often mild and temporary. | Jitters, anxiety, increased heart rate, or sleep disruption. |
Conclusion
Yes, you can take beta-alanine anytime. Its performance benefits stem from consistently increasing muscle carnosine levels over weeks, not from the timing of a single dose. Aim for a daily intake of 3–6 grams for at least four weeks. Splitting the dose can help manage paresthesia. Prioritizing consistent daily intake, regardless of when, is the best approach to maximize its potential for high-intensity endurance.
